#a57f4e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a57f4e is composed of 64.7% red, 49.8%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 33.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.8% and a lightness of 47.6%. #a57f4e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ffe9c with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#a57f4e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a57f4e has RGB values of R:165, G:127,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.53,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10846030.

Shades and Tints of #a57f4e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050402 is the darkest color, while #fbf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a57f4e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807a73 is the less saturated color, while #f08803 is the most saturated one.
